CINAHL
Cumulative Index to Nursing & Allied Health Literature Bibliographic and Full Text for approximately 800,000 records including nursing, allied health, biomedicine, and healthcare. Full text is included for several state nursing journals and some newsletters, standards of practice, practice acts, government publications, research instruments and patient education material.

HAPI
Provides information about behavioral measurement instruments. Records contained in HaPI provide information on questionnaires, interview schedules, vignettes/scenarios, coding schemes, rating and other scales, checklists, indexes, tests, projective techniques, and more.

MEDLINE
MEDLINE® with Full Text provides authoritative medical information on medicine, nursing, dentistry, veterinary medicine, the health care system, pre-clinical sciences, and much more. MEDLINE® with Full Text uses MeSH (Medical Subject Headings) indexing with tree, tree hierarchy, subheadings and explosion capabilities to search citations from over 4,800 current biomedical journals. MEDLINE® with Full Text is also the world's most comprehensive source of full text for medical journals, providing full text for more than 1,470 journals indexed in MEDLINE.

Primal Pictures
Primal Pictures was created to serve as the only complete and medically accurate 3D model of human anatomy. It is derived from genuine medical scan data that has been interpreted by a team of anatomists and then translated into three-dimensional images by graphics specialists. The anatomy visuals are accompanied by 3D animations that demonstrate function, biomechanics and surgical procedures. Clinical videos, MRI scans and text written by medical specialists supplement the core anatomy data.

PsycNET
PsycNET® is the American Psychological Association's (APA) resource for abstracts and full text from scholarly journal articles, book chapters, books, and dissertations, is the largest resource devoted to peer-reviewed literature in behavioral science and mental health. This resource is a combination of two major psychology databases - PsycINFO and PsycARTICLES.
